The Moonbeam Children's Book Awards
Designed to bring increased recognition to exemplary children's books and their creators and to support childhood literacy and life - long reading, the awards are given in 38
categories covering the full range of subjects, styles, and age groups that children's books are written and published in today.

- Define your book's main / secondary genre - Research the top 10 books / authors in your main genre (Amazon page, pricing, # of likes, tags,
categories, reviews,
covers, book description, websites, social media activity / presence)- Develop a positioning statement and messages that will speak to readers of this genre but also differentiate your book -
Design book
cover keeping in mind what is selling in your genre and how you have positioned your book - Begin building social media presence (website, blog, FB fan page, twitter, pinterest, tumblr, slideshare, author profiles)- Decide on book formats (ebook, print, enhanced e-book) and distribution channels - Set the books price competitively, relative to the competition - Create the book launch plan and budget
